Responsibilities
- Employment & legal: End-to-end management of employment contracts, work permits, and visa processes in Germany and internationally, including EOR arrangements
- Payroll: Running and overseeing monthly payroll, ensuring accuracy and compliance across entities
- Benefits: Managing our existing benefits stack and proactively identifying, proposing, and implementing new offerings as we scale
- Team culture: Planning and coordinating team events and off-sites, both locally and abroad
- Office operations: Acting as the point of contact for our coworking space and handling day-to-day operational needs
- HR processes & compliance: Designing, documenting, and improving people processes as we grow, with a strong eye on German labor law and cross-border compliance topics

Requirements
- 2-4 years in People Ops, HR, or a closely related role, ideally in a fast-growing startup
- Solid understanding of German employment law; experience with international hiring or EORs is a plus
- Structured, hands-on, and comfortable operating with limited oversight
- Fluent in English; German is a strong plus
- Start ASAP in Berlin - Hybrid

Additional Information
Deltia is growing fast, and we need someone to own the operational backbone that makes that possible. As our People Operations Manager, you'll work directly with the founders and our Talent & People Manager to scale our team from ~30 to 100+ people over the next two years. This is a hands-on, high-ownership role at the intersection of compliance, process design, and employee experience.
